Carhartt WIP and RAMIDUS Deliver a Tote Bag Collection

Carhartt WIP works in collaboration with Japanese bag label RAMIDUS on a new collection centering on tote bags for the season. The two forces deliver bags in the classic duck canvas options along with a nylon iteration as well. The bags are available in two different size variations and it uses the aforementioned classic duck canvas material in the colorway options of either beige or black.

This adds a versatile style to the design and stays true to the workwear roots of the brand. The alternative option that rounds out the collection comes in a weatherproof nylon design. It is also detailed with oversized Carhartt branding details along the front and finished with RAMIDUS straps.
